Some people consider country to be the straight-on-country only, I include neotraditionalists. I consider the neotraditionalists the ones that really change what country sounds like and keep it country. For example, I DO consider Kenny Chesney, Brad Paisley, Luke Bryan, Rodney Atkins, Garth Brooks, Toby Keith, Tim McGraw - to be country even though they don't have that Merle or Willie sound.
Then there's the obvious guys like Josh Turner, Randy Travis, Waylon - who are bare-bones true country. Love their sound too.
Then there's pop-country which I'm not as big of a fan of. SOME of it I consider to be country, some I don't. Usually I'll say "these guys aren't country," haha - but that's not saying necessarily they don't belong on country radio. I think labels would be pleasantly surprised if they put out a couple more neotraditionalists wearing cowboy hats! Stop shooting for boy-band/pop style. Think about it, almost every real major superstar has had a cowboy hat. Alan Jackson, Tim McGraw, George Strait, Garth, Toby Keith, Brad Paisley - all major headliners with that I consider to be a neotraditionalist sound and all wearing cowboy hats.
